/ Check-in [bec5b6d4]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Avoid superfluous cursor seeks in "INSERT OR REPLACE" statements.
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| trunk
Files: files | file ages | folders
SHA1: bec5b6d4d083556d111a89186b4f7b35b5e7cebf
User & Date: dan 2016-11-08 19:22:32
Context
2016-11-09
00:57
Remove the "experimental" marking from the sqlite3_preupdate interfaces. But be sure all the interface definitions are within documentation. check-in: d6dd2ad3 user: drh tags: trunk
00:10
Enhance the OP_IdxInsert opcode to optionally accept unpacked key material. check-in: 89d958ab user: drh tags: unpacked-IdxInsert
2016-11-08
19:22
Avoid superfluous cursor seeks in "INSERT OR REPLACE" statements. check-in: bec5b6d4 user: dan tags: trunk
17:19
Avoid generating OP_TableLock unnecessary instructions on btrees that are not sharable. check-in: 8cb8516d user: drh tags: trunk
Changes
Unified Diffs Side-by-Side Diffs Patch

Changes to src/insert.c.

Changes to src/vdbe.c.